WebFeb 2, 2024 · This mass to density calculator is a simple tool to convert mass to density or density to mass if you know the object's volume. In this article, we shall briefly discuss: … WebFeb 2, 2024 · You can arrive at this answer through these steps: The mass of the Earth is 5.97237 ×1024 kg, and its volume is 1.08321 ×1012 km3. Divide the mass of the Earth by its volume to get its density, 5,514 ×10-9 kg/km3, which is equal to 5.514 g/cm3. Congratulations, you've calculated the mean density of the Earth! WebJun 13, 2011 · Mass vs. Weight. This laboratory activity worksheet engages students in an exploration of mass and weight. Students use a balance to measure the mass and a spring scale to measure the weight of a series of objects. They then analyze the data to determine the relationship between these two quantities and conceptualize the distinction between …
